Description
Launched on 24th December 2013, the scheme "Construction of Warehouse for Grain Storage" by the Panchayat and Rural Development Department, Government of Madhya Pradesh aims to provide modern and scientific food grain storage facilities under Food Security Act 13 to interested applicants in rural areas. The application has to be made to the concerned Gram Panchayat. After depositing the prescribed fee in the Gram Panchayat, permission for the construction work will be issued by the Gram Panchayat. The application can be made online.

Eligibility Criteria
1. The applicant should be located in a rural area of Madhya Pradesh.
2. The applicant should be engaged in activities related to grain storage or agriculture.
3. The applicant should have access to one acre of land or the land required as per the circumstances, allotted by the Cooperative Department.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: What is the objective of the scheme?
A: The scheme aims to provide modern and scientific food grain storage facilities by constructing godowns in rural areas of Madhya Pradesh.

Q: Who is eligible to apply for the scheme?
A: Registered cooperative societies involved in agricultural or grain storage activities in rural areas of Madhya Pradesh are eligible.

Q: What type of land is required for constructing a godown?
A: The applicant must have one acre of land or the land required as per the circumstances, allotted by the Cooperative Department.

Q: What facilities are provided under the scheme?
A: The scheme supports the construction and maintenance of modern and scientific food grain storage godowns.

Q: How can cooperative societies benefit from this scheme?
A: Cooperative societies can enhance grain storage capacity, ensure scientific storage methods, and reduce post-harvest losses.

Q: Is there any financial assistance provided under the scheme?
A: Details about financial assistance or subsidies should be confirmed with the Panchayat and Rural Development Department.

Q: Are individual farmers eligible to apply for this scheme?
A: No, this scheme is specifically for registered cooperative societies.

Q: What is the role of the Cooperative Department in this scheme?
A: The Cooperative Department facilitates the allotment of land required for constructing the godown.

Q: Where can applications for the scheme be submitted?
A: Applications can be submitted to the Panchayat and Rural Development Department or the Cooperative Department of Madhya Pradesh.

Q: What is the expected outcome of this scheme?
A: The scheme aims to improve rural grain storage infrastructure, reduce wastage, and support agricultural development.
